To be eligible for the B.Tech programs at Aurora University, applicants must have:
• Completed 10+2 or equivalent with Physics, Mathematics, and Chemistry/Computer Science
• Qualified in a recognized entrance exam (such as JEE Main / CUET UG/ AURUM (Aurora University Admission Test)
• Met the minimum aggregate percentage as per program requirements
• Admissions are based on merit, followed by counselling or interview rounds where applicable.
Qualify AURUM UG.
Candidates having valid JEE mains/ CUET UG score are exempted from AURUM UG.

To graduate with a B.Tech degree, students must:
• Earn 280 credits through coursework, labs, projects, certifications, and enrichment activities
• Complete internships, a capstone project, and external certifications
• Fulfil requirements in core education, research, foreign language, and talent & enrichment
Maintain minimum academic performance and adhere to the university’s code of conduct and attendance policies
